* BookEnds: The first and last episode of season 1 (split into two parts, by the way) involves Diane throwing a party; the former due to Diane being threatened with eviction since the apartment belonged to her sister Bonnie, and the latter [[spoiler:celebrating her lotion company being bought by Borough and using the money she made to officially purchase the apartment]].

* LawOfInverseFertility: Bonnie's arc in season 2 involves her attempts to get pregnant again after suffering from EmptyNest syndrome. [[spoiler:A later episode reveals that due to her age, her body can't allow for a natural pregnancy anymore.]]
